A young violinist, Katarina, arrives at the Pieta orphanage in Venice where Antonio Vivaldi was music director. The only clue to her family heritage, is a ring left with her as a baby. Aided by the colorful gondolier Giovani, she searches througout Carnaval and the Island of the Dead for her origins. In a touching final scene, a masked stranger unites the young girl with her family, and Katarina must choose between staying with Vivaldi and her music, or going out into the world.

Music includes exerpts from:
The Four Seasons,
The Piccolo Concerto,
The Guitar Concerto and others.
